Transaction 59cae50f148c4f4e40e45a51a143d10ae315038426b20be08213ae947dd82647
1 Input
1 Output
-
59cae50f148c4f4e40e45a51a143d10ae315038426b20be08213ae947dd82647:0
- value
- 307900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8682f43d86811ca9cd4c75538d7a5758a49e16e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DGERZ5moFRBTBXwKK9jtJ3HpwBzDLKGdS